Saint-Gobain Isover UK Limited Whitehouse Industrial Estate Runcorn Cheshire WA7 3DP Tel: 0800 032 2555 e-mail: isover.enquiries@saint-gobain.com website: www.isover.co.uk This Agrement Certificate Products Sheet(1) relates to CWS 36, CWS 34 and CWS 32 for Full Fill, unfaced glass mineral wool slabs for use as full fill thermal insulation in new external masonry cavity walls, up to 25 metres in height, in new buildings of a domestic and non-domestic nature (additional requirements apply for buildings above 12 metres). The products are installed during construction. (1) Hereinafter referred to as 'Certificate'. CERTIFICATION INCLUDES: • factors relating to compliance with Building Regulations where applicable • factors relating to additional non-regulatory information where applicable • independently verified technical specification • assessment criteria and technical investigations • design considerations • installation guidance • regular surveillance of production • formal three-yearly review. Thermal performance — the products have declared thermal conductivities (Ad) of 0.036 W-m-1-K-1 for CWS 36, 0.034 W-m-1-K-1 for CWS 34 and 0.032 W-m-1-K-1 for CWS 32 (see section 6). Water resistance — the products will resist the transfer of water across the cavity (see section 7). Condensation risk — the products can contribute to limiting the risk of condensation (see section 8). Behaviour in relation to fire — the products have a reaction to fire classification of Class A1 to BS EN 13501-1 : 2007 (see section 9). Durability — the products are durable, rot proof, water resistant and sufficiently stable to remain effective as insulation for the life of the building (see section 11). 3 Delivery and site handling 3.1 The slabs are delivered to site in polythene-wrapped packs. Each pack contains a label bearing the manufacturer’s name, board dimensions and the BBA logo incorporating the number of this Certificate. 3.2 The slabs should be stored clear of the ground, on a clean level surface and preferably under cover to protect them from prolonged exposure to moisture or mechanical damage. 3.3 It is recommended that dust masks, gloves and long-sleeved clothing are worn during the cutting and handling of the products. 3.4 Damaged, contaminated or wet products must not be...

Buildings over 12 metres high and up to and including 25 metres high 4.9 Where the walls of a building are between 12 and 25 metres high, the following requirements also apply: • from ground level, the maximum height of a continuous cavity must not exceed 12 metres. Above 12 metres, the maximum height of continuous cavity must not exceed 7 metres. In both cases, breaks should be in the form of continuous horizontal cavity trays and weepholes discharging to the outside • the area to be insulated must not be an...

9 Behaviour in relation to fire The products have a reaction to fire classification* of Class A1 to BS EN 13501-1 : 2007 and are, therefore defined as non-combustible under the national Building Regulations. 10 Maintenance As the products are confined within the wall cavity and have suitable durability (see section 11), maintenance is not required. 11 Durability The products are unaffected by the normal conditions in a wall, and are durable, rot proof, water resistant and sufficiently stable to remain effective as insulation for the life of the building.
